Lucky Strike Entertainment (NYSE:LUCK – Get Free Report) announ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day. The company reported ($0.20) E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.05) by ($0.15), Zacks reports. The company had revenue of $303.95 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$311.30 million.

Key Lucky Strike Entertainment News
- Positive Sentiment: Management projected fiscal 2027 adjusted EBITDA of $340 million to $360 million and revenue of approximately $1.28 billion to $1.31 billion. The company also reduced its planned capital expenditures to $90 million, which could improve free cash flow. Lucky Strike fiscal 2027 outlook
- Positive Sentiment: Lucky Strike declared a quarterly cash dividend of $0.06 per share, payable September 22 to shareholders of record as of September 8. The dividend equates to $0.24 annually and a reported yield of about 3.8%, potentially attracting income-focused investors. Lucky Strike declares dividend
- Neutral Sentiment: Fiscal fourth-quarter revenue increased 0.9% year over year to $303.9 million, while the full-year figure rose 3.7% to $1.245 billion. The company ended the period with 366 locations, including 159 Lucky Strike locations. Lucky Strike fiscal 2026 results
- Negative Sentiment: Fourth-quarter EPS was a loss of $0.20, substantially worse than the expected $0.05 loss, and revenue of $303.95 million missed the $311.30 million consensus estimate. Lucky Strike misses fourth-quarter estimates
- Negative Sentiment: Operating trends weakened: same-store revenue fell 2.5% year over year, fourth-quarter adjusted EBITDA declined to $74.1 million from $88.7 million, and full-year adjusted EBITDA dropped to $333.2 million from $367.7 million. These results suggest near-term profitability and consumer demand remain concerns. Lucky Strike fiscal results analysis

Lucky Strike Entertainment Company Profile
Lucky Strike Entertainment Corp. engages in operating bowling centers. It offers entertainment concepts with lounge seating, arcades, food and beverage offerings, and hosting and overseeing professional and non-professional bowling tournaments and related broadcasting. The company was founded by Thomas F. Shannon in 1997 and is headquartered in Mechanicsville, VA.
